凭证的数据库设计包括什么

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    凭证的数据库设计包括以下内容:

    1. 凭证表(Voucher Table):凭证表是数据库中最主要的表,用于存储所有的凭证信息。每个凭证都有一个唯一的标识符(ID),以及凭证的日期、凭证编号、凭证摘要等信息。

    2. 科目表(Account Table):科目表用于存储所有的科目信息。每个科目都有一个唯一的编号(Account Code),以及科目的名称、科目类型、科目余额等信息。凭证表中的每个凭证都会涉及到多个科目,因此科目表是凭证数据库设计中的重要一部分。

    3. 分录表(Entry Table):分录表用于存储凭证的分录信息。每个凭证都包含至少两个分录,一个借方分录和一个贷方分录。分录表中的每一行都对应着一个分录,包含分录的凭证ID、科目编号、借方金额、贷方金额等信息。

    4. 辅助核算表(Auxiliary Table):辅助核算表用于存储凭证中涉及到的辅助核算项目的信息。辅助核算项目可以是客户、供应商、项目等。辅助核算表中的每一行都对应着一个辅助核算项目,包含项目的唯一标识符、项目类型、项目名称等信息。

    5. 凭证审核表(Voucher Review Table):凭证审核表用于记录凭证的审核信息。每个凭证在提交之后需要经过审核,审核表中记录了审核的状态、审核人员、审核时间等信息。凭证审核表可以帮助管理者了解凭证的审核情况,确保凭证的准确性和合规性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    凭证是会计核算中的重要组成部分,用于记录和证明企业的经济交易和业务活动。凭证的数据库设计需要考虑以下几个方面:

    1. 凭证表设计:凭证表是存储凭证信息的主要表,需要包含凭证编号、凭证日期、凭证摘要等字段。此外,还可以根据实际需求增加其他字段,如制单人、审核人等。

    2. 分录表设计:分录表是存储凭证分录信息的表,每个凭证通常包含多个分录。分录表需要包含凭证编号、分录编号、科目编号、借方金额、贷方金额等字段。此外,还可以考虑增加其他字段,如分录摘要、辅助核算项等。

    3. 科目表设计:科目表用于存储企业的会计科目信息,包括科目编号、科目名称、科目类型等字段。科目表可以按照科目分类进行设计,以便于查询和统计。

    4. 辅助核算表设计:辅助核算表用于存储与会计科目相关的辅助核算信息,如客户、供应商、员工等。辅助核算表需要包含辅助核算项编号、辅助核算项名称等字段。

    5. 其他相关表设计:根据实际需求,还可以考虑设计其他相关表,如单位表、币种表、凭证模板表等,以满足特定的业务需求。

    此外,在凭证的数据库设计中,还需要考虑索引的设计,以提高数据查询的效率。可以根据经常使用的查询条件设计相应的索引,如凭证日期、科目编号等。

    总的来说,凭证的数据库设计需要考虑凭证表、分录表、科目表、辅助核算表等主要表的设计,同时需要考虑索引的设计,以满足会计核算的需要。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    凭证是一种记录企业经济业务活动的会计凭证,它是会计核算的基本依据。凭证的数据库设计主要包括以下几个方面:

    1. 凭证表的设计:凭证表是存储凭证数据的主要表,它通常包括以下字段:

      • 凭证编号:每个凭证都有唯一的编号,用于区分不同凭证。
      • 凭证日期:记录凭证的日期。
      • 凭证摘要:简要描述凭证所涉及的经济业务活动。
      • 借方金额:记录借方金额。
      • 贷方金额:记录贷方金额。
      • 凭证状态:记录凭证的状态,如已审核、未审核等。
      • 凭证类型:记录凭证的类型,如收入凭证、支出凭证等。
      • 创建时间:记录凭证的创建时间。
      • 修改时间:记录凭证的最后修改时间。
    2. 分录表的设计:分录表是存储凭证分录数据的表,它与凭证表存在一对多的关系。分录表通常包括以下字段:

      • 分录编号:每个分录都有唯一的编号,用于区分不同分录。
      • 凭证编号:与凭证表关联的外键字段,用于表示该分录所属的凭证。
      • 科目编号:表示该分录所涉及的科目。
      • 借贷标志:表示该分录是借方还是贷方。
      • 金额:表示该分录的金额。
      • 创建时间:记录该分录的创建时间。
      • 修改时间:记录该分录的最后修改时间。
    3. 科目表的设计:科目表是存储科目信息的表,它通常包括以下字段:

      • 科目编号:每个科目都有唯一的编号,用于区分不同科目。
      • 科目名称:记录科目的名称。
      • 科目类型:表示科目的类型,如资产、负债、所有者权益、成本、收入、费用等。
      • 创建时间:记录科目的创建时间。
      • 修改时间:记录科目的最后修改时间。
    4. 辅助核算表的设计:辅助核算表是存储辅助核算数据的表,它与凭证表和分录表存在一对多的关系。辅助核算表通常包括以下字段:

      • 辅助核算编号:每个辅助核算都有唯一的编号,用于区分不同辅助核算。
      • 凭证编号:与凭证表关联的外键字段,用于表示该辅助核算所属的凭证。
      • 分录编号:与分录表关联的外键字段,用于表示该辅助核算所属的分录。
      • 辅助核算类型:表示辅助核算的类型,如客户、供应商、项目等。
      • 辅助核算名称:记录辅助核算的名称。
      • 辅助核算值:记录辅助核算的值。
      • 创建时间:记录辅助核算的创建时间。
      • 修改时间:记录辅助核算的最后修改时间。

    以上是凭证的数据库设计的主要内容,根据实际业务需求,还可以根据需要添加其他字段,如凭证审核人、审核时间等。同时,还需要考虑索引的设计,以提高凭证数据的查询效率。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部